Poinsettias for the Homebound
By St Mary Administrator @ 11:39 AM :: 210 Views :: Article Rating :: Human Concerns
 
Each year, as part of Advent, parishioners have the opportunity to share with the homebound of the parish. This weekend, December 12-13, envelopes will be placed in the pews, for donation of money, to be used towards the purchase of poinsettias for the 200 who are homebound or in nursing homes from our tri-cluster parish. And again, because of parishioner generosity (last Advent/Christmas), we collected enough money to buy flowers for all Catholics, who are in a nursing home, who are homebound, or who are on the Communion list. Each poinsettia costs $5 but any amount will be greatly appreciated. On December 19-20, parishioners will be invited to pick up a plant and deliver poinsettias to the 200 homebound members of our tri-cluster parish, during that week.
